What Is Microsoft SharePoint?
SharePoint is a versatile web-based platform designed for collaboration and document management. Widely used by organizations to enhance productivity and streamline workflows, it supports:
- Real-time co-authoring
- Advanced search capabilities
- Customizable document libraries
This allows users to organize content efficiently.
Workflow automation for reducing repetition and security for protecting data are key features. It also includes seamless integration with other Microsoft applications like Teams and OneDrive.
Thanks to cloud-based architecture, it’s accessible from any device. This makes it ideal for effectively fostering collaboration and managing corporate content. Google Workspace users will notice many similarities.

3. Security and permissions
SharePoint improves security by giving organizations control over who can access information. Permissions can be set at the site, list, folder, or item level. This helps ensure sensitive information is only available to authorized users. It lets your organization control access at a detailed level. This ensures the right people can see the right information..
The program also makes it easier to manage access without exposing unnecessary information. It does this by supporting:
- Permission groups
- Role-based access
- Inherited settings
This reduces oversharing. It protects confidential content. It also helps administrators enforce least-privilege access across the organization.

7. Compliance and governance
In practice, SharePoint provides a structured way to manage records. It also helps businesses meet internal and external compliance standards.
The platform supports compliance and governance by helping your organization:
- Keep content for the right amount of time
- Apply lifecycle rules
- Enforce policy-based controls
It supports retention, lifecycle management, and policy-based controls. These features help businesses meet regulatory requirements.
With it, administrators can control how long information is kept. They can also decide how it is reviewed and when it is archived or deleted. This reduces legal risk and supports audit readiness. At the same time, it helps ensure sensitive information is handled consistently. This consistency applies across the organization.
